Buritt L. Bulloch founded this establishment alongside his wife, Mamie Bulloch, and opened in 1972. For over 40 years, Old Fashioned Donuts has been serving the Roseland community and the Chicago-land area with fresh donuts daily. Old Fashioned has been featured in multiple food magazines and even on Chicago’s Best! People come from all over just to try our donuts. We serve breakfast Monday through Friday, and lunch daily.
